a{
color: #bbb;
text-decoration: none;
}
a:hover{
color: #d4d4d4;
text-decoration: none;
}
a:active{
color: #d4d4d4;
text-decoration: none;
}

img {
	border: 0;
	padding: 0;
	margin: 0;
}

body{
color: #fff;
font-family: Arial, Verdana, Helvetica, Sans-serif;
font-size: 11px;
margin: 0;
padding: 0;
}

table{
color: #C4C4C4;
font-family: Arial, Verdana, Helvetica, Sans-serif;
font-size: 11px;
}

input{
font-family: Arial, Verdana, Helvetica, Sans-serif;
font-size: 10px;
}
textarea{
font-family: Arial, Verdana, Helvetica, Sans-serif;
font-size: 10px;
}
select{
font-family: Arial, Verdana, Helvetica, Sans-serif;
font-size: 10px;
}




/* NAVIGATION STYLES 
///////////////////////////////////////////////////////////////*/


#nav {
	position: absolute;
	top: 20px;
	margin: 0;	/* top right bottom left*/
	padding: 0;
	background:url('/img/topbg.gif') repeat-x;
	width:960px;
	height:60px;
	}

#nav ul	{
	list-style: none;
	padding: 0;
	margin: 0 0 0 225px;
	border-left:1px solid #fff;
	} 

/* Hide from IE5-Mac \*/
#nav li a	{
	float: none;
	margin: 0;
	padding: 0;
	}
/* End hide */ 

#nav li {
	float:left;
	padding: 0;
	height: 60px;
	line-height: 18px;
	}
	
/*  GENERAL CLASS */
#nav li a{	
	color: #fff;
	margin: 0;
	padding: 20px 10px 14px 10px;
	float: left;
	text-decoration:none;
	font-weight: bold;
	text-transform: uppercase;	
	display: block;
	height:60px;
	border-right:1px solid #8e8e8e;
	}

/*  LIST CLASSES */
#nav li.TopLink, #nav li.TopLinkDeny {
	/*background: transparent url('/img/nav/bg_toplinks_folder_left_off.png') no-repeat top left;*/
	}
	
#nav li.TopLinkActive, #nav li.TopLinkActiveDeny {
	background: transparent url('/img/topnavactive.gif') repeat-x;
	color:#fff;
}
	


/*  LINK CLASSES */
#nav li.TopLink a, #nav li.TopLink a:visited, #nav li.TopLinkDeny a, #nav li.TopLinkDeny a:visited{
	/*background-image: url('/img/nav/bg_toplinks_folder_right_off.png');*/
	background-repeat: no-repeat;
	background-position: top right; 
	}

#nav li.TopLink a:hover, #nav li.TopLinkDeny a:hover {
	background-image: url('/img/topnavbg_on.gif');
	background-repeat: repeat-x;
	background-position: top right; 
	color: #e8e8e8;
	}

#nav li.TopLinkActive a, #nav li.TopLinkActive a:visited, #nav li.TopLinkActive a:hover, #nav li.TopLinkActiveDeny a, #nav li.TopLinkActiveDeny a:visited, #nav li.TopLinkActiveDeny a:hover{
	/*background-image: url('/img/nav/bg_toplinks_folder_right_on.png');*/
	background-repeat: no-repeat;
	background-position: top right; 
	color: #e8e8e8;
	}
	

/* If menu is using only two horizontal levels (toplinks and toplinks2). */

#nav2	{
	list-style: none;
	padding: 0;
	margin: 0;
	} 

#nav2 ul	{
	list-style: none;
	padding: 0;
	margin: 0;
	} 

/* Hide from IE5-Mac \*/
#nav2 li a	{
	float: none;
	margin: 0;
	padding: 0;
	}
/* End hide */ 

#nav2 li {
	float:left;
	padding: 0;
	margin: 0; /* top right bottom left*/
	height: 25px;
	line-height: 18px;
	}
	
/*  GENERAL CLASS */
#nav2 li a {	
	color: #333;
	margin: 0 0 0 16px;
	padding: 2px 8px 2px 0;
	float: left;
	text-decoration:none;
	font-weight: bold;
	text-transform: uppercase;	
	display: block;
	}


#HomeLink {
	z-index: 999;
	width: 218px;
	height: 60px;
	position: absolute;
	top: 20px;
	left: 0;
	overflow: hidden;
	z-index:999;
	}
	
#HomeLink #Logotype
{
	background:url('/img/logo.gif') top left no-repeat;
	width:218px;
	height:60px;
	position:absolute;
	top:0;
	left:0;
	z-index:997;
}

#TopNav	{
	position: absolute;
	z-index: 996;
	width: 900px;
	right: 10px;
	top: 1px;
	margin: 0;
	padding: 0;
	text-align: right;
	}

#TopNav ul	{
	list-style: none;
	margin: 0;
	padding: 0;
	text-align: right;
	}
	
#TopNav ul li	{
	float: right;
	margin: 0;
	padding: 2px 10px;
	text-align: right;
	}


/*  DEMO SETTINGS */


#ChangeLanguage, #ChangeNav {
	font-weight: bold;
	position: absolute;
	z-index: 999;
	left: 20px;
	margin: 0;
	padding: 3px;
	background: #666;
	opacity:.30;
	filter: alpha(opacity=30);
	-moz-opacity: 0.3;
}

#ChangeLanguage:hover, #ChangeNav:hover {
	background: #333;
	opacity:.100;
	filter: alpha(opacity=100);
	-moz-opacity: 1.0;
}

#ChangeLanguage	{
	top: 160px;
	}

#ChangeNav	{
	top: 185px;
	}

